High-Thermal-Conductivity Radiative Cooling Films for Enhanced Passive Daytime Cooling

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ces
Passive daytime radiative cooling (PDRC) technology relies on reflecting solar visible light that carries high energy and radiating surface heat to a low-temperature cold background in the long-wave infrared band, thereby achieving clean energy-saving cooling.

Passive radiative cooling: Not such an off-the-wall idea

Physics Today
A growing class of materials can cool horizontal surfaces to below the ambient temperature with no power input. Now there’s a material that works on vertical surfaces too.
